Chanos chanos, commonly known as milkfish or bangus, is a staple aquaculture species across Southeast Asia. Indo Alam Semesta supplies boneless milkfish in graded sizes bands of 150 to 500 grams, 500 to 800 grams, 800 to 1000 grams, and 1000 grams upward. Each fish is manually deboned in a hygienic processing environment, with workers extracting the pin bones, rib cage, and vertebral column so that no fragments remain. The fresh raw material is handled under chilled conditions from harvest through packing, and the final product is frozen for export.
The flesh of milkfish is off-white, moderately oily, and carries a mild, slightly sweet flavour that suits both Asian and Western preparations. Standard industry practice for boneless bangus involves butterfly filleting, removal of the abdominal cavity, and thorough rinsing before IQF or block freezing. Typical bone retention after skilled manual processing is under 0.1 percent by weight, though buyers should specify their target threshold and require a batch certificate. Standard frozen shelf life at minus 18 degrees Celsius is 12 months; vacuum skin packaging is common for retail, while bulk cartons with polyliner suit food-service channels.
The primary buyers are importers serving Filipino, Indonesian, and diaspora markets in North America, the Middle East, and East Asia. Applications include pan-frying, grilling, steaming, and use in sinigang or paksiw. Restaurants, frozen-food distributors, and ethnic retail chains are the core customer segments. Before placing an order, verify that Indo Alam Semesta holds valid export registration with Indonesia's fisheries authorities and can provide a health certificate for your destination country. Request a product specification sheet that confirms size-grade distribution, net weight after glaze, bone-fragment limits, and microbiological standards including total volatile basic nitrogen and histamine. Ask for reference customers or a track record of shipments to your market, and consider an independent pre-shipment inspection if the supplier has no recorded response data.
Logistics for frozen seafood from Makassar typically move via reefer container to major transshipment hubs such as Singapore or direct to Northeast Asian and Middle Eastern ports. Confirm with Indo Alam Semesta the Incoterms they offer, FOB Makassar being common, and whether they can handle CFR or CIF to your discharge port. Payment terms should be discussed directly, letter of credit or documentary collection being standard for first transactions with an unrated supplier. Clarify carton dimensions, pallet configuration, and container load quantities to optimise freight costs.
Upon arrival, inspect container temperature records and check for thaw-refreeze indicators such as ice crystallisation or carton staining. Draw samples for thawed drip-loss measurement, target below 5 percent for well-frozen fillets, and conduct a cook test to assess texture and absence of bone fragments. Retain samples for laboratory analysis of histamine, total plate count, and coliforms if the destination requires it. Ensure all documentation, health certificates, and catch certificates align with the carton markings and purchase order before releasing payment.
